Narrative:
Construction number 1644. Military serial number TJ630. Sold on July 31, 1947. Registered in Pakistan as AP-AEC. Aircraft met an accident on November 12, 1951. Damaged beyond economical repair. Registration AP-AEC removed from Pakistan Aircraft Register on June 12, 1952.
